BZF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2014 in Review
14 of the 3,479 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in WisdomTree Brazilian Real Strategy Fund (BZF) for Q2 2014, worth a combined $6.78M — down 10% from $7.55M a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 3 funds closed out of BZF and 1 opened new positions — a net loss of 2 holders — while 5 trimmed existing stakes and 2 added.
The largest buyer was Morgan Stanley, adding an estimated $853K. The largest seller was Stifel Financial, exiting entirely with an estimated $958K sold.
